OTRS 6.0 Community Edition.
Сделал тестовый веб-сервис, настроил тестовый дефолтный invoker, назначил ему XSLT в качестве маппера. Но когда я пытаюсь сохранить стили в XSLT Editor в том числе взятые прямо с оф. сайта, мне выдаётся окно с ошибкой: "One or more errors occured". И больше ничего.
Пример стилей:
Код: Выделить всё
<?xml version="1.0" encoding="UTF-8"?>
<xsl:transform
xmlns:xsl="https://www.w3.org/1999/XSL/Transform"
xmlns:date="https://exsalt.org/dates-and-times"
version="1.0"
extension-element-prefixes="date">
<xsl:output method="xml" encoding="utf-8" indent="yes" />
<!-- Don't return unmached tags -->
<xsl:template match="text()" />
<!-- Remove empty elements -->
<xsl:template match="*[not(node())]" />
<!-- Root template -->
<xsl:template match="RootElement">
<xsl:copy>
<TicketID>
<xsl:value-of select="/issues/id" />
</TicketID>
<Ticket>
<DynamicField>
<Name>customfield</Name>
<Value>
<xsl:value-of select="/issues/status/name" />
</Value>
</DynamicField>
</Ticket>
</xsl:copy>
</xsl:template>
</xsl:transform>
Спасибо.